**Handover: Quillscale autoscaler (from Dara to Ome)**

Quick summary for the sync: the queue-depth autoscaler is stable, but the scale-down hysteresis is still tuned conservatively — we hold capacity for 10 minutes after depth drops, which costs us a bit during quiet hours. Don't shorten it without checking the Fenwick batch jobs; they spike in bursts. Pending work: metrics cardinality cleanup and the long-promised dry-run mode. Everything else, including config history and my notes on past incidents, is on the team page.

runbook for tajep-yahig: https://artifactory.lumictech.corp/repo

For the incoming director. This covers the proposed Summit tier for our Larkbase product. The tier adds priority support, expanded storage, and audit tooling, targeting mid-market accounts in the Veldane region. Pilot feedback from twelve customers was positive; churn risk appears low. Pricing sits 40% above the current Plus tier. Finance projects breakeven within two quarters. Rollout is staged: pilot expansion, then general availability. Before the review, please read the confidential note appended below.

board note of fafog-yahap: Project Rusdor slips by a full year because of the audit delay.

## Changelog — ProctorQueue 4.2

Changed defaults for the exam-proctoring queue in Veriscan. Idle reviewer timeout drops from 900s to 300s; max concurrent sessions per proctor falls from 8 to 5. Overflow now routes to the standby pool instead of rejecting. Flag `strict_identity_check` is on by default. No migration required; restart picks up new values. Reviewers should confirm the diff touches only defaults, not validation logic. The effective configuration after this change is as follows:

deployment values, yadug-bawif:
[framir]
team = pelox
access_code = ac_a38ab2
owner = tamion.julael
host = framir.tolvaqlabs.test
port = 11211
peer = tammir.zemvargrid.local
salt = 2215ef03
pin = 1541